Kilmer was never just another actor. He was the youngest person ever accepted into Juilliard, a performer with raw talent, intensity, and a magnetic presence. His portrayal of Jim Morrison was so convincing, fans thought he was Morrison reincarnated.

When he donned the Batman suit in 1995, Kilmer was at the pinnacle of his career. But after Batman Forever, he was replaced without warning or explanation, and the silence was deafening.
Director Joel Schumacher later described Kilmer as “psychotic” and difficult, but Mel Gibson suggests the real reason for Kilmer’s exile went deeper. Gibson claims Kilmer refused to play by Hollywood’s unspoken rules—he didn’t flatter the right people, he questioned authority, and he wouldn’t stay silent when others expected him to.
In Hollywood, bad behavior isn’t always punished, but refusing to follow the script can get you quietly blacklisted. Kilmer himself admitted in interviews that he hadn’t gotten a studio job in 15 years, saying, “I’m kind of blacklisted. Not in a way—I am.”
Kilmer’s honesty about his struggles is striking. He acknowledges that he spoke up too much, didn’t appreciate the business side of Hollywood, and projected his insecurities onto others.

Kilmer documented everything, filming thousands of hours of home videos and behind-the-scenes footage, as if he knew he might one day need evidence. His 2021 documentary, “Val,” is a testament to his struggle to not be erased from history.
As darker rumors about Hollywood circulated—secret societies, exploitation, and blacklists—Kilmer’s disappearance seemed less like coincidence and more like consequence.
When Kilmer returned in “Top Gun: Maverick,” fans saw it as a comeback, but it felt more like a farewell. His voice in the film was recreated using AI and old recordings; physically, he was fighting cancer and exhaustion. After Maverick, Kilmer withdrew from public life, his silence more poignant than ever.
